Area Schools Provide Meals Over Summer

ANOKA COUNTY, Minn. – As the school year comes to a close, some children wonder where their daily summer meals will come from. The Anoka-Hennepin, Spring Lake Park, and Centennial School Districts are participating in the Summer Food Service program supported by the US Department of Agriculture.
At more than 15 different schools across the area, students ages two to 18 can receive free breakfast and lunch Monday through Friday throughout the summer. Adults can purchase discounted meals for $2-$4. All children are welcome at any site regardless of whether or not they attend school at the host location.
